Interview: Tim Berners-Lee

Updated on 08 July 2008

By Kylie Morris

Father of the world wide web, Sir Tim Berners-Lee, talks to Kylie Morris.

He's the genius credited with creating the world wide web, calling it a space without boundaries.

But now Tim Berners-Lee is in a battle to save the web from those he says want to restrict it. But who is he talking about?

More4 News speaks to him in an exclusive interview.
